Job Description

When you join Verizon you become part of a team that powers how people live, work, and play by connecting them to what brings them joy. At Verizon, innovation, creativity, and impact are at the core of everything we do. As part of the V Team, you will collaborate, grow, and contribute to building reliable and advanced network solutions.

As a network engineer, your primary responsibility will be to develop and maintain Python scripts to automate workflows for the Wireless NMC.

You will also conduct data analysis, diving deep into wireless trouble tickets and alarms to identify trends and their business impact.

Interpret wireless network trouble ticket worklog entries by understanding existing automation workflows to effectively answer end-user questions.

Roles & Responsibilities

  • Develop and maintain Python scripts to automate workflows for the Wireless NMC.
  • Conduct data analysis on wireless trouble tickets and alarms to identify trends.
  • Interpret worklog entries to support end-user queries.
  • Analyze data and provide insights for business impact.

Requirements / Skills

  • Bachelor’s degree or one or more years of relevant work experience.
  • Advanced knowledge of operating systems and applications.
  • Proficiency in computing programming.
  • Demonstrated troubleshooting skills for analyzing complex solutions and problems.
  • Experience with Oracle/SQL database administration.
  • The ability to quickly learn, adapt, and convert code to new scripting languages.
  • Willingness to work a schedule that includes overlap with the US day shift.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ering, Industrial Engineering, Computer Science, Supply Chain Management, Statistics, or Economics.
  • Experience with large-scale IT systems.
  • Python certification.
  • Experience with JavaScript & React for web-based tool development.
  • Project management skills.
  • Experience providing support to hundreds of users of developed applications.
  • Strong interpersonal skills with a commitment to quality and user satisfaction.

Work Schedule

  • Hybrid work model with work from home and office days.
  • 40 hours per week.
